Required Documents for the ICMAI Registration Process

Preparing your documents before starting the registration form can make the process smoother. Depending on your registration level and circumstances, commonly required information or documents may include:

  • Recent passport-size photograph
  • Signature
  • Academic qualification documents
  • Class 10 certificate or equivalent
  • Class 12 certificate or equivalent
  • Graduation documents, where applicable
  • Government-issued identity proof
  • Category certificate, where applicable
  • Other documents specified by ICMAI

The exact requirements can vary by applicant and registration route. It is better to check your documents before uploading them with the history of ICMAI. Make sure:

  • Your name matches your academic records.
  • Your photograph is recent and meets the specified format.
  • Your signature is clear.
  • Your certificates are readable.
  • Your uploaded files meet the required size and format.

Do not wait until the final day to discover that a document does not meet the portal's specifications. Prepare everything in advance.

Deadlines related to the ICMAI Registration Process

Deadlines matter. If you want to appear for a particular examination term, you must complete the relevant registration requirements within the applicable timeline. ICMAI publishes important dates for its academic and examination processes. These dates can include:

  • Registration cut-off dates
  • Examination application dates
  • Fee payment deadlines
  • Form correction windows
  • Examination schedules
  • Other important student deadlines

Do not rely on an old blog or social media post for the latest deadline. Dates can change between examination terms. Instead, check the official ICMAI announcements and student portal regularly.

Important Deadlines

This is the part students should take very seriously. ICMAI registration is generally open throughout the year. However, there are cut-off dates if you want to become eligible for a specific examination term. The standard ICMAI admission cut-offs currently listed are:

  • June examination term - 31 January
  • December examination term - 31 July

These dates apply to Foundation and Intermediate admissions under the published ICMAI admission guidance. However, there is another important point.

ICMAI can extend a registration deadline.

For example, the June 2026 admission/registration/enrolment deadline was extended to 10 February 2026. ICMAI also published an official circular dated 28 July 2026 extending the last date for admission, registration, and enrolment for the December 2026 term.

Therefore, never depend only on an old blog or calendar. Check ICMAI's Student News, Circulars, and Notifications for your specific attempt. Also remember:
